An Effective Trust-Based Search Approach in Peer-to-Peer Network

In this paper, a novel optimized trust-based search approach was proposed for the peer-to-peer (P2P) platform. In traditional trust-based or recommendation P2P system, the trust or recommendation value of a peer is considered when selecting it for forwarding messages or downloading resources, while the other factors are ignored, such as good download rate, good response rate, and on-line time similarity. In the proposed optimized approach, we consider all possible factors which affect the search quality in the P2P system. The proposed algorithm is developed on the well-known QueryCycle platform. Experiment results show the efficiency of our approach.

[1]  Hector Garcia-Molina,et al.  EigenRep: Reputation Management in P2P Networks , 2003 .

[2]  Julita Vassileva,et al.  Trust and reputation model in peer-to-peer networks , 2003, Proceedings Third International Conference on Peer-to-Peer Computing (P2P2003).

[3]  Rakesh Kumar,et al.  Optimal peer selection for P2P downloading and streaming , 2005, Proceedings IEEE 24th Annual Joint Conference of the IEEE Computer and Communications Societies..

[4]  Tyson Condie,et al.  Simulating A File-Sharing P2P Network , 2003 .

[5]  Karl Aberer,et al.  Managing trust in a peer-2-peer information system , 2001, CIKM '01.

[6]  Ernesto Damiani,et al.  A reputation-based approach for choosing reliable resources in peer-to-peer networks , 2002, CCS '02.

[7]  Ling Liu,et al.  PeerTrust: supporting reputation-based trust for peer-to-peer electronic communities , 2004, IEEE Transactions on Knowledge and Data Engineering.

[8]  Ernesto Damiani,et al.  A protocol for reputation management in super-peer networks , 2004 .

[9]  Nahid Shahmehri,et al.  Dynamic trust metrics for peer-to-peer systems , 2005, 16th International Workshop on Database and Expert Systems Applications (DEXA'05).

[10]  Ernesto Damiani,et al.  A protocol for reputation management in super-peer networks , 2004, Proceedings. 15th International Workshop on Database and Expert Systems Applications, 2004..

[11]  G. Elofson Developing Trust with Intelligent Agents: An Exploratory Study , 2001 .

[12]  Quan-Ke Pan,et al.  Research on Peer Selection in Peer-to-Peer Networks using Ant Colony Optimization , 2008, 2008 Fourth International Conference on Natural Computation.

[13]  Catholijn M. Jonker,et al.  Formal Analysis of Models for the Dynamics of Trust Based on Experiences , 1999, MAAMAW.

[14]  Partha Dasgupta,et al.  A role-based trust model for peer-to-peer communities and dynamic coalitions , 2004, Second IEEE International Information Assurance Workshop, 2004. Proceedings..